About 5-chloro-N-(3-methylbutyl)pentanamide
5-chloro-N-(3-methylbutyl)pentanamide (PubChem CID 28733512) has the molecular formula C10H20ClNO
and a molecular weight of 205.73 g/mol. Its IUPAC name is 5-chloro-N-(3-methylbutyl)pentanamide.
